The preset is a simple text file (Ok, XML). You download it, then you us
F12, Tagging Presets to point JOSM to it. Now it's a new entry under
Presets in the menu. That's not entirely practical yet.

You can do right mouse button on the task bar though, and add buttons for
the different presets.

One preset helps to map highway, surface, source and source:date in one go.

The imagery used is simply Bing. Use Right mouse button where there is no
data, Show Tile Info to know the date of the imagery.

Sometimes the imagery is of low resulotion or there is cloud cover and thus
unusable. You now have a button to easily mark that (fixme=low accuracy).

The idea of the task is also to mark the sideways of the main road. There
is another button, which adds fixme=unfinished.

There is also a button which addes fixme=cannot be completed. I forget when
to use that one.

Roads tend to get split up, based on the quality of the imagery and of its
date in these tasks.

Maybe it should be emphasized these sort of tasks don't require each and
every building to be mapped, but we do like to know where the
settlements/villages/cities are.

The bounds of the tasks are merely a 'suggestion' and it's unlikely you'll
have conflicts with nearby tasks, so there is no real need to stop where
the download ended. Just like there is no real need to keep mapping to the
edge of the downloaded area.

About the source tags. I had started to add the source tag on the
changeset, instead of on each and every object. Therefore, my personal
preference would be to not use source, but only use source:date with a list
like:

source:date=Bing:2014;Mapbox:2011

Usually just source:date=Bing:2013 though.

> I spent a few hours trying to get started on Task #1245 Burkina Faso,
> consolidated mapping, Base Roads Check <
> http://tasks.hotosm.org/project/1245> last night, but gave up in the end.
> I had two problems (with another down the line, probably):
>
> -- I had forgotten, if I ever knew, how to add presets in JOSM. It didn't
> help that I muddled presets and plugins in my mind. A couple of sentences
> should be added to say how to do this. I don't mind updating that part of
> the Wiki, assuming I have the authority.
>
> --  The second point is that the instructions usually provide a URL for
> the imagery to be ysed. I couldn't find any such URL. As a general comment,
> the gRoads link is to to a text description, and if you do a lot of
> link-following from there you eventually get to the database gRoads uses.
> But I don't think that is what the project activators intended.
>
> -- It's not clear what that preset is for. You probably need a few lines
> explaining that.
>
> I believe these comments also apply to two or three sister tasks.
